Empowering Emirati Talent: Dubai's Real Estate Developer Gathering

The Dubai Land Department (DLD), in conjunction with Dubai Silicon Oasis (DSO), has initiated a developer meeting as part of the Emirati Real Estate Business Incubator Programme. This crucial initiative aims to bolster the participation of Emirati talent in Dubai’s real estate market.

Enhancing Skills and Industry Connections

The meeting constituted a significant step in the programme's first phase, facilitating exchanges between participants and prominent real estate developers. It provided a platform for networking, knowledge sharing, and hands-on industry experiences.

This initiative is aimed at assisting trainees in bridging the gap between academic education and practical application by linking them with active projects, insights into the market, and viable business opportunities.

Aiding National Entrepreneurial Aspirations

The Emirati Real Estate Business Incubator is an integral part of the national vision titled “The Emirates: The Startup Capital of the World”, under the auspices of His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um. Its goal is to cultivate a robust entrepreneurial environment for Emiratis within the real estate sector.

It involves collaboration with Dubai Silicon Oasis, the New Economy Academy, and Rochester Institute of Technology Dubai (RIT Dubai), creating a cohesive training framework to innovate future real estate brokers and entrepreneurs.

Connecting Developers with Aspiring Professionals

The meeting reinforced collaboration between developers and programme participants, granting them access to project information, marketing avenues, and structured mentorship. Participants also gain from personalized guidance sessions and advanced real estate tools alongside industry incentives.

According to officials, these programs are pivotal in transforming trainees into market-ready professionals equipped to launch and manage their real estate firms.

Insights from Leadership

Badr Buhannad, Director General of Dubai Silicon Oasis, noted the importance of this programme in empowering local talent and setting them up for long-term success in real estate.

Eng. Abdullah Ahmed Al Shehhi, CEO of the Real Estate Regulatory Agency (RERA), stressed that the initiative is about more than just training; it focuses on fostering competitive enterprises that support the growth of Dubai’s real estate landscape.

Fostering a Sustainable Real Estate Landscape

This programme embodies Dubai’s vision for a resilient and innovative real estate environment led by skilled Emiratis. Through tailored training and direct industry engagement, it aspires to establish sustainable career pathways while enhancing market competitiveness.
